It's not really an efficient enough cooler for engine oil, and the extra thermal stresses added to the stock cooling system may well tip it over the edge. best to stick to liquid to air for the engine oil, unless you go for a much more efficient water rad, then something like the Laminova liquid / liquid coolers are excellent see http://www.laminova.se

 

The stock PAS cooler isn't very good, and I am seeing a few cars where PAS pump failure MAY have been exacerbated by the fluid becoming overheated. If you have the cooler the water system will easily deal with the PAS heat and it wouldn't be at all hard to plumb it up.

PAS fluid on the MKIV can get VERY hot, I feel this is one reason the pumps fail. If you have time, money and incliabtion a better cooling solution is a proper baby transmission cooler in the opposite duct to the stock I/c, or even IN the stock I/C duct now you have a FMIC, and use the ducting provided out into the low pressure area of the O/S front wheel arch.
